Gloucestershire Cricket Cap, blue wool, Gloucestershire logo embroidered on front, made by Shaheen, named inside to 'P. Bainbridge'. G/VG condition. Phil Bainbridge played 324 First-Class matches for Gloucestershire 1977-90 & Durham 1992-96
